240 發(fā)簡(jiǎn)信
IP屬地:廣東
  • javaScript數(shù)據(jù)結(jié)構(gòu)和算法--快速排序

    快速排序時(shí)最常用的排序算法念赶,和歸并排序一樣也是采用分治方法,但沒(méi)有把數(shù)組分割開(kāi)惊楼,也是將原數(shù)組分成較小的數(shù)組狰右。 1杰捂、從數(shù)組的中間選擇一項(xiàng)作為主元。...

  • javaScript數(shù)據(jù)結(jié)構(gòu)和算法--歸并排序

    歸并排序是一種分治算法棋蚌,分而治之嫁佳,將原始數(shù)組拆分成最小粒度的數(shù)組(數(shù)組的長(zhǎng)度是1),接著將這些小數(shù)組進(jìn)行歸并(merge),直到成為一個(gè)排序好的...

  • javaScript數(shù)據(jù)結(jié)構(gòu)和算法--插入排序

    插入排序每次排一個(gè)數(shù)組項(xiàng)谷暮,類似平時(shí)抓牌的模式蒿往,假設(shè)第一項(xiàng)已經(jīng)是排好序的,接著第二項(xiàng)和第一項(xiàng)比較湿弦,如果第二項(xiàng)比第一項(xiàng)小瓤漏,則第二項(xiàng)插入第一項(xiàng),以此類...

  • javaScript數(shù)據(jù)結(jié)構(gòu)和算法--選擇排序

    選擇排序是一種比較原址的比較排序算法。先找到數(shù)據(jù)結(jié)構(gòu)中最小值并放在第一位蔬充,接著找到第二小的值放在第二位 選擇排序的算法實(shí)現(xiàn): function ...

    0.3 49 0 1
  • javaScript數(shù)據(jù)結(jié)構(gòu)和算法--冒泡排序

    冒泡排序比較任何兩個(gè)相鄰的數(shù)蝶俱,如果第一個(gè)數(shù)比第二個(gè)數(shù)大,則交換這兩個(gè)數(shù)饥漫,元素向上移動(dòng)至正確的位置榨呆。 冒泡排序的算法實(shí)現(xiàn): function Bu...

  • javaScript數(shù)據(jù)結(jié)構(gòu)--散列表

    散列集合是由一個(gè)集合構(gòu)成,但是插入趾浅、移除愕提、或獲取元素時(shí),使用的是散列函數(shù) 散列表的代碼實(shí)現(xiàn) // 散列表 function LinkedList...

  • javaScript數(shù)據(jù)結(jié)構(gòu)--字典

    在字典中存儲(chǔ)的值是【鍵皿哨、值】對(duì),字典和集合很相似纽谒,集合以【值证膨、值】的形式存儲(chǔ)。字典也稱作映射鼓黔。 字典的代碼實(shí)現(xiàn): function Dictio...

  • javaScript數(shù)據(jù)結(jié)構(gòu)--集合

    集合是由一組無(wú)序且唯一的項(xiàng)組成的: 集合可以進(jìn)行 并集央勒、交集、差集澳化、子集操作崔步。 集合的代碼實(shí)現(xiàn): function Set() { var ...

  • javaScript數(shù)據(jù)結(jié)構(gòu)--雙向鏈表

    雙向鏈表和普通鏈表的區(qū)別是,普通鏈表中一個(gè)節(jié)點(diǎn)只有一個(gè)next指針指向下一個(gè)節(jié)點(diǎn)缎谷,雙向鏈表有2個(gè)指針井濒,一個(gè)指向下一個(gè)節(jié)點(diǎn),一個(gè)指向前面一個(gè)節(jié)點(diǎn)列林。...

亚洲A日韩AV无卡,小受高潮白浆痉挛av免费观看,成人AV无码久久久久不卡网站,国产AV日韩精品